当前位置: 首页 > news >正文

网页设计网站开发需要什么百度竞价推广是什么

网页设计网站开发需要什么,百度竞价推广是什么,网络游戏挣钱的有哪些,门头广告设计图片文章目录 一、全局组件1.创建全局组件2.在main.js中注册全局组件3.使用全局组件 二、局部组件1.创建局部组件2.在另一个组件中注册、使用局部组件 三、Props1.定义一个子组件2.定义一个父组件3.效果 代码仓库:跳转 本博客对应分支:03 一、全局组件 Vue…

文章目录

  • 一、全局组件
    • 1.创建全局组件
    • 2.在main.js中注册全局组件
    • 3.使用全局组件
  • 二、局部组件
    • 1.创建局部组件
    • 2.在另一个组件中注册、使用局部组件
  • 三、Props
    • 1.定义一个子组件
    • 2.定义一个父组件
    • 3.效果

代码仓库:跳转
本博客对应分支:03

一、全局组件

Vue 3 中的全局组件是在应用程序中全局注册的组件,可以在任何地方使用,而不需要在每个组件中都单独注册。

1.创建全局组件

在components目录下创建全局组件MyGlobalComponent.vue:

<!-- components/MyGlobalComponent.vue -->
<template><div>This is my global component</div>
</template><script>
export default {name: 'MyGlobalComponent'
};
</script>

2.在main.js中注册全局组件

import { createApp } from 'vue';
import App from './App.vue';const app = createApp(App);// 注册全局组件
import MyGlobalComponent from './components/MyGlobalComponent.vue';
app.component('MyGlobalComponent', MyGlobalComponent);app.mount('#app');

3.使用全局组件

在App.vue中尝试使用我们定义和注册的全局组件:

<!-- App.vue -->
<template><div id="app"><!-- 使用全局组件 --><MyGlobalComponent ></MyGlobalComponent><HelloWorld /></div>
</template><script>
import HelloWorld from './components/HelloWorld.vue';export default {name: 'App',components: {HelloWorld}
};
</script>
  • 效果:

在这里插入图片描述

二、局部组件

在 Vue 3 中,局部组件是指在单个组件内部注册和使用的组件。这意味着局部组件只能在其父组件内部使用,而无法在其他组件中直接使用。要在 Vue 3 中创建一个局部组件,可以在父组件的 components 选项中注册它,然后在父组件的模板中使用它。

1.创建局部组件

在components目录下创建局部组件MyLocalComponent.vue:

<!-- components/MyLocalComponent.vue -->
<template><div><h2>这是局部组件</h2><p>我只能在父组件内部使用</p></div>
</template><script>
export default {name: 'MyLocalComponent'
};
</script>

2.在另一个组件中注册、使用局部组件

<!-- App.vue -->
<template><div id="app"><!-- 使用全局组件 --><MyGlobalComponent></MyGlobalComponent><!-- 使用局部组件 --><MyLocalComponent></MyLocalComponent><HelloWorld /></div>
</template><script>
// 引入并注册局部组件
import HelloWorld from './components/HelloWorld.vue';
import MyLocalComponent from './components/MyLocalComponent.vue';export default {name: 'App',components: {HelloWorld,MyLocalComponent}
};
</script>
  • 效果:

在这里插入图片描述

三、Props

在 Vue 3 中,props 是用于从父组件向子组件传递数据的机制。通过 props,父组件可以向子组件传递数据,子组件可以接收并使用这些数据。

1.定义一个子组件

在components目录下创建一个子组件ChildComponent.vue:

我们定义了一个名为 message 的 prop,并使用了 props 的验证功能。我们指定了它的类型为 String,并且设置为必需的(required: true)。这意味着父组件在使用 ChildComponent 时必须传递一个名为 message 的字符串类型的数据。

<!-- ChildComponent.vue -->
<template><div><h2>子组件</h2><p>{{ message }}</p></div></template><script>export default {props: {message: {type: String,required: true}}};</script>

2.定义一个父组件

在components目录下创建一个子组件ParentComponent.vue:

在父组件中,我们使用了 v-bind 或者简写的 : 语法将 parentMessage 数据传递给了 ChildComponent 的 message prop。这样,parentMessage 的值就会被传递到 ChildComponent 中,并在子组件中使用。

<!-- ParentComponent.vue -->
<template><div><h1>父组件</h1><ChildComponent :message="parentMessage" /></div>
</template><script>
import ChildComponent from './ChildComponent.vue';export default {components: {ChildComponent},data() {return {parentMessage: '这是来自父组件的消息'};}
};
</script>

3.效果

为了便于在页面上展示,我们在App.vue中注册ParentComponent为局部组件:

<!-- App.vue -->
<template><div id="app"><!-- 使用全局组件 --><MyGlobalComponent></MyGlobalComponent><!-- 使用局部组件 --><MyLocalComponent></MyLocalComponent><HelloWorld /><ParentComponent></ParentComponent></div>
</template><script>
// 引入并注册局部组件
import HelloWorld from './components/HelloWorld.vue';
import MyLocalComponent from './components/MyLocalComponent.vue';
import ParentComponent from './components/ParentComponent.vue';export default {name: 'App',components: {HelloWorld,MyLocalComponent,ParentComponent}
};
</script>
  • 效果:

在这里插入图片描述


文章转载自:
http://dinncointervallic.zfyr.cn
http://dinncoprosit.zfyr.cn
http://dinncohyperoxide.zfyr.cn
http://dinncodigitigrade.zfyr.cn
http://dinncounearned.zfyr.cn
http://dinncozygoma.zfyr.cn
http://dinncohymn.zfyr.cn
http://dinncosanskritist.zfyr.cn
http://dinncosarcous.zfyr.cn
http://dinncoseptuagenary.zfyr.cn
http://dinncocholecystography.zfyr.cn
http://dinncoexpiry.zfyr.cn
http://dinncoblockade.zfyr.cn
http://dinncoovibovine.zfyr.cn
http://dinncoerbium.zfyr.cn
http://dinncoborax.zfyr.cn
http://dinncofirstborn.zfyr.cn
http://dinncoeyelashes.zfyr.cn
http://dinncofretsaw.zfyr.cn
http://dinncocalor.zfyr.cn
http://dinncotentaculiferous.zfyr.cn
http://dinncofacinorous.zfyr.cn
http://dinncoeyeleteer.zfyr.cn
http://dinncocinerous.zfyr.cn
http://dinncoextremeness.zfyr.cn
http://dinncodendroid.zfyr.cn
http://dinncobusiest.zfyr.cn
http://dinncojurancon.zfyr.cn
http://dinncosparkproof.zfyr.cn
http://dinncoimpenitency.zfyr.cn
http://dinncochalcis.zfyr.cn
http://dinncointernet.zfyr.cn
http://dinncodisassociate.zfyr.cn
http://dinncoaxminster.zfyr.cn
http://dinncofos.zfyr.cn
http://dinncobequeath.zfyr.cn
http://dinncormt.zfyr.cn
http://dinncocana.zfyr.cn
http://dinncoelise.zfyr.cn
http://dinncodornick.zfyr.cn
http://dinncomultimer.zfyr.cn
http://dinncochildishly.zfyr.cn
http://dinncoanthranilate.zfyr.cn
http://dinncohandbag.zfyr.cn
http://dinnconeuropathology.zfyr.cn
http://dinncobranchial.zfyr.cn
http://dinncooverbred.zfyr.cn
http://dinncotribunism.zfyr.cn
http://dinncosecern.zfyr.cn
http://dinncomantid.zfyr.cn
http://dinncoabirritate.zfyr.cn
http://dinncocaprolactam.zfyr.cn
http://dinncohogwild.zfyr.cn
http://dinncorustic.zfyr.cn
http://dinncoprance.zfyr.cn
http://dinnconandin.zfyr.cn
http://dinncosynaptosome.zfyr.cn
http://dinncobounteously.zfyr.cn
http://dinncoostitic.zfyr.cn
http://dinncooptimal.zfyr.cn
http://dinncoblameworthy.zfyr.cn
http://dinncorockfall.zfyr.cn
http://dinncorameses.zfyr.cn
http://dinncobatracotoxin.zfyr.cn
http://dinncospaceband.zfyr.cn
http://dinncocacography.zfyr.cn
http://dinncoxenogenesis.zfyr.cn
http://dinncoallottee.zfyr.cn
http://dinncoalky.zfyr.cn
http://dinncogynobase.zfyr.cn
http://dinncoslagging.zfyr.cn
http://dinncosochi.zfyr.cn
http://dinncosurtax.zfyr.cn
http://dinncofujisan.zfyr.cn
http://dinncoflako.zfyr.cn
http://dinncokaraism.zfyr.cn
http://dinncoampholyte.zfyr.cn
http://dinncorangey.zfyr.cn
http://dinncoappreciably.zfyr.cn
http://dinncorhytidome.zfyr.cn
http://dinncoimpressionable.zfyr.cn
http://dinncomethylmercury.zfyr.cn
http://dinncoindistributable.zfyr.cn
http://dinncofabricate.zfyr.cn
http://dinncogroundnut.zfyr.cn
http://dinncovinyl.zfyr.cn
http://dinncoelasticizer.zfyr.cn
http://dinncosubjection.zfyr.cn
http://dinncoregrow.zfyr.cn
http://dinncoamildar.zfyr.cn
http://dinncolooming.zfyr.cn
http://dinncoworkless.zfyr.cn
http://dinncomauritania.zfyr.cn
http://dinnconeutrophil.zfyr.cn
http://dinncopurposeless.zfyr.cn
http://dinncoraconteuse.zfyr.cn
http://dinncotusker.zfyr.cn
http://dinncobazzoka.zfyr.cn
http://dinncoinsurgent.zfyr.cn
http://dinncomuscovitic.zfyr.cn
http://www.dinnco.com/news/133009.html

相关文章:

  • web网站开发培训学校百度交易平台官网
  • 旅游攻略网站开发腾讯中国联通
  • 做海报的参考网站seo搜索引擎优化包邮
  • 沈阳专门代做网站的深圳网络推广大师
  • 网站首页设计方案常见的网络推广方式包括
  • 大丰有没有做网站东莞seo网站优化排名
  • 做家具网站网站关键词优化怎么弄
  • 线上宣传渠道和宣传方式深圳seo优化seo优化
  • 开发门户网站长沙疫情最新消息今天封城了
  • 青岛高新区建设局网站搜索网站哪个好
  • wordpress4.2.8 留言本网站优化培训
  • 网站开发有哪些认证网络营销专业代码
  • wordpress调用相关评论电商seo是什么
  • 哪个网站有做车库门的怎么宣传自己的店铺
  • 网站备案的要求是什么广州seo排名优化服务
  • 新疆建设工程综合信息网seo外包公司需要什么
  • 做网站要遵守的基本原则广东清远今天疫情实时动态防控
  • 网站建设制作设计营销公司南宁2022年小学生新闻摘抄十条
  • b2b就是做网站吗无锡百姓网推广
  • 做网站java好还是php优化设计答案大全
  • 如何做产品销售网站seo的课谁讲的好
  • 自己做的网站怎么在百度能搜到百度推广登陆平台
  • 北京疫情死亡人数最新消息揭阳seo快速排名
  • 专业做生鲜的网站海外品牌推广
  • 网站建设需要营业执照吗阿里云域名注册流程
  • 哪个医学网站大夫可以做离线题做市场推广应该掌握什么技巧
  • 找公司做网站源代码给客户吗腾讯广告联盟官网
  • python做网站表白竞价排名是什么
  • 做网站会什么软件今天热点新闻事件
  • 外国人学做中国菜 网站郑州百度seo网站优化